Certainly! Most of them you can fish out of the code (it's written in sea),
but I can give you some pointers.

The idea behind netrek is that your race starts with 10 oysters, which
produce pearls (certain "agricultural" oysters produce pearls much faster
and thus are very valuable). The object of the game is to capture all of
the enemy's oysters by destroying all of their pearls and capturing them
with your own pearls. Each team has 8 fish attacking and defending the
oysters.

One of the most important ideas is to destroy enemy pearls (once you
destroy all the pearls on an enemy oyster, it becomes uncontrolled and
you can capture it by delivering one of your own pearls). You do this
by perching on the oyster and hitting 'b' (for bash), which causes
you to destroy the enemy pearls there.

If the oyster has more than 4 pearls, then it will be open and you
can attack all of them; however, once the oyster has less than 5, it
will close up with the pearls inside and you can't bash them anymore
(however, if you get lucky, you can bash several pearls in one swing
and thus reduce the number of pearls to below 4 before it closes up..
lobsters are very good at this).

Once the oyster is closed up, the only way to destroy the rest of the
pearls inside is to deliver your own pearls to the oyster. When you
put one of your own pearls next to the oyster, it will open up slightly
to crush it, which allows you to grab one of the ones inside and destroy
it before it closes again. Thus, for an oyster with 4 pearls, you need
to deliver 4 of your own pearls to be able to destroy all of the ones
inside, which makes the oyster uncontrolled. Then, if you put another
one of your own pearls inside, you will capture the oyster and it will
start making pearls for you.

The tricky bit is that to carry pearls around, you have to have a net
to carry them in. You make the net out of the scales of the enemy fish
that you defeat. Defeating one enemy fish gives you enough scales to
carry 2 pearls (unless you are in a lobster, in which case you have
enough to carry three pearls). They maximum number of pearls you can
carry depends on fish type. When your fish is defeated in combat,
you lose all your scales and any pearls you are carrying, and get sent
back to your spawning grounds to get a new fish. 

You fight either by tossing pebbles at the enemy fish, or by using
your scraper to scrape the scales off of them; note that after a
lot of fighting you get tired, and can't attack until you get more food
(indicated by your food stat, note that many other things, including
movement, consume food). You can get a little food anywhere, but certain
oysters provide food, which means that if you perch on a freindly food
oyster you will replace your food reserves much faster.

There are six types of fish you can control: salmon, dogfish, crabs,
bluefin, lobsters, and the mighty bass. You can always switch to
another fish by going back to your spawning ground and requesting
a new fish (and you keep whatever scales you had).

Salmon are small and fast. The have fast pebbles but very weak
scrapers, and they are too weak for most combat. They are best used
either for carrying pearls, or for bashing enemy pearls in their
backfield (every good team needs a salmon basher).

Dogfish are a little tougher than salmon, and also conserve food well.
However, they also have weak scrapers and thus aren't so useful in combat.
In fact, these fish tend to be seldom seen anymore.

Crabs are the workfish. They have lots of food and really good
scrapers, which makes them good for fighting enemy fish. Nowadays
these fish are used more than any other.

Bluefin are very big fish, but are slow and don't use food effectively,
so they tend to be useful only in close range fights near a food oyster.

Lobsters are an intersting sort of fish. They are very slow, but are
very good at bashing enemy pearls (if they get lucky, they can bash
4 pearls in one swing). They also can carry three pearls for each
enemy fish destroyed, which can be quite useful.

The bass is a very special fish. You side only can have one at a time,
and if it gets defeated it takes 30 minutes to put it back together
again. You also have a certain rank to take one. However, they are
very big and tough, and serve as a repository for pearls (where they
can't be bashed).

An interesting tactic is the bass og (it's short for ogtopus). This
is where your 8 fish surround the enemy bass (like the 8 arms of an
ogtopus). Then you wade in and beat the carp out of him. You can do
it with less fish, but it's not as effective.

# artwork specifications

# galaxy is 100000 x 100000 pixels
# tactical dimensions are one fifth of galactic dimensions

# tactical is 20000 x 20000 galactic pixels,
# shown by regular client on 500 x 500,
# therefore a ratio of 40

# ships are 20 x 20 on regular client,
# therefore ships are 800 x 800 galactic pixels

# regular client galactic of 500 x 500 means a ratio of 200,
# therefore a ship size of 4 x 4 pixels (text shown instead)

# torpedo explosion range is 350 galactic pixels,
# therefore 8.75 regular client pixels,
# which is just inside the drawn shield radius

# upscaling to 1000 x 1000 tactical means a new ratio of 80,
# therefore a ship size of 40 x 40 pixels

# upscaling to 1000 x 1000 galactic means a new ratio of 100,
# therefore a ship size of 8 x 8 pixels

# planet orbital radius is 800 galactic pixels (ORBDIST)
# planet attack radius is 1500 galactic pixels (PFIREDIST)
# on regular client, tactical planets are 28 pixels diameter
# on regular client, galactic planets are 14 pixels diameter
# planets are 30 x 30 on regular client tactical
# planets are 60 x 60 on this tactical

""" netrek protocol documentation, from server include/packets.h

	general protocol state outline

	starting state

	CP_SOCKET
	CP_FEATURE, optional, to indicate feature packets are known
	SP_MOTD
	SP_FEATURE, only if CP_FEATURE was seen
	SP_QUEUE, optional, repeats until slot is available
	SP_YOU, indicates slot number assigned

	login state, player slot status is POUTFIT
	client shows name and password prompt and accepts input

	CP_LOGIN
	CP_FEATURE
	SP_LOGIN
	SP_YOU
	SP_PLAYER_INFO
	various other server packets

	outfit state, player slot status is POUTFIT
	client shows team selection window

	SP_MASK, sent regularly during outfit

	client accepts team selection input
	CP_OUTFIT
	SP_PICKOK, signals server acceptance of alive state

	alive state,
	server places ship in game and play begins

	SP_PSTATUS, indicates PDEAD state
	client animates explosion

	SP_PSTATUS, indicates POUTFIT state
	clients returns to team selection window

	CP_QUIT
	CP_BYE
"""
